Mathieu Matégot's organic forms and lightness of touch create a sense of joy and the ground breaking and innovative techniques that he applied resulted in unique aesthetics and, above all, contemporary designs. Today, Matégot's designs are equally fit for the purpose as when they were originally conceived, and his legendary designs are both timeless and classic. The Nagasaki chair is one of few three-legged chairs and is still Matégot's best-known piece. It is included in the permanent exhibition at the Vitra Design Museum. The Copacabana chair is included in the design collection at the Museum of Decoratives Arts in Paris and the design collection at the Georges Pompidou Centre, National Museum of Modern Art, Industrial centre, Beaubourg, Paris. Mathieu Mategot Yellow Metal Dedal Wall Book Shelf
Located in Atlanta, GA
Very nice large modular wall mounted shelf designed in the 1950s by French Mathieu Mategot (1910-2001) and known as the "dedal" bookcase. Featuring folded and perforated yellow lacquered steel metal. This wall shelf can be hung alone or in a grouping. Produces in France by Ateliers Mategot. In the 1950s, Mategot creates new material, the steel mesh that he calls "Rigitulle", and develops a machine that can shape sheet metal like a fabric. The ultra-graphic lines of the Dedal shelf remain incredibly modern, more than half a century after its creation.
